You can look for specific reviewers who tend to like the same kinds of movies as you, then see what they think. Or, look at the reviews instead of the score. I tend to look at an average review, a positive review and a negative review, to see if I care about any of the bad parts they bring up.
Nutrition isn’t just about filling up some hunger bar counted in calories, otherwise we should just grow sugar everywhere and diet coke would be idiotic. Cow milk has more calcium naturally (it gets added to the alternatives), more protein (soy milk comes close, almond milk does not), but more saturated fat (the others have healthier fats)
